Cellist David Dietz has performed across North America, Europe and Asia and is comfortable in a wide range of settings as a performer and educator. His belief in classical music’s ability to strengthen communities and bring people together has driven his involvement in many creative projects spanning from kindergarten classrooms to concert halls. Recent season highlights include recitals at the Chinese University of Hong Kong and Beijing’s Central Conservatory of Music, a series of community concerts in the Houston Public Library system with Trio Menil.
